Obama campaign hammering McCain with advertising in battleground states
Submitted by R. Neal on Fri, 2008/10/24 - 1:49pm.
Nielsen Media Research says Obama ads are running more than two to one v. McCain in the key battleground states of Colorado, Florida, Georgia, Missouri, Ohio, Pennsylvania, and Virginia. Between October 6 and October 22, Obama ran 150% more ads (53,049 v. 21,106) than McCain, including 240% more ads in Florida at 15,887 v. McCain’s 4,662. Here's the breakdown by state.
In related news, this presidential election will cost more than $1.5 billion, and the total for presidential and Congressional races will exceed an unprecedented $5.3 billion, says the Center for Responsive Politics. According to their analysis, Democrats and incumbents have the upper hand in fundraising. They also note that 527 fundraising has declined.
